36 Stockbreach Road is a mid-terrace house in Hatfield (AL10 0BD). It has a recorded floor area of 84 m² (around 904 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(November 2020) shows a D (score 65),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since March 2010.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Poor to Good and lighting went from Very Poor to Good; while roof ef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 2-band jump.
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 5%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£349,000 is 21%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£319/sq ft) was about 49.3%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 84 m² it's 24.4% larger than the typical home in the postcode (68 m² median across 28 EPCs). Sold June 2021 for £288,500.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
